Here's a killer version of Black Mountain Rag performed by Steve Kaufman and 12-year-old Presley Barker at the concert that followed Steve's Flatpicking Guitar Workshop at Lowe Vintage Instrument Co. in Burlington NC on February 11th, 2017.
